Immediate-early 2 protein (IE2) of human cytomegalovirus is a nuclear phosphoprotein encoded by the UL122 gene and produced immediately after viral infection from the major immediate-early locus[2][3]. IE2 is essential for activating a broad spectrum of early viral genes, facilitating viral genome replication and lytic infection. Multiple isoforms (notably IE2 p86, p60, and p40) are generated by alternative splicing, but all share a conserved DNA-binding and dimerization domain[2]. IE2 functions as a master regulator by interacting directly with viral chromatin, RNA polymerase II, and various host and viral proteins, including TBP, TFIIB, and UL84[2]. It exhibits both positive and negative regulatory roles: it transactivates early viral genes and represses its own promoter, thereby balancing viral gene expression for productive infection[2][3]. IE2 activity is crucial for HCMV pathogenesis, particularly in immunocompromised individuals, but its essential and cytotoxic nature makes direct targeting therapeutically challenging.
